The National Weather Service in Little Rock AR has issued a Flood Warning for the following river in Arkansa
S: White River At Augusta affecting Woodruff and White Counties. For the Lower White Riverincluding Newport, Augusta, Georgetown, Des Arc, ClarendonMinor flooding is forecast.
What: Minor flooding is forecast.
Where: White River at Augusta.
When: From Thursday afternoon to early Saturday morning.
Impacts: At 26.0 feet, Farm ground along the river in White and Woodruff counties begin to flood. Seasonal agricultural impacts.
Additional Details: - At 9:00 AM CDT Sunday the stage was 16.5 feet. - ForecastThe river is expected to rise to a crest of 26.0 feet early Thursday afternoon (June 18). It will then fall below flood stage Thursday evening. - Flood stage is 26.0 feet. - http://www.weather.gov/safety/flood

Recommended Action

Turn around, don't drown when encountering flooded roads. Most flood deaths occur in vehicles. Motorists should not attempt to drive around barricades or drive cars through flooded areas. Flooding is occurring or is imminent. Most flood related deaths occur in automobiles. Do not attempt to cross water covered bridges, dips, or low water crossings. Never try to cross a flowing stream, even a small one, on foot. To escape rising water find another route over higher ground. River forecasts are based on current conditions and rainfall forecasted to occur over the next 24 hours. During periods of flooding...Evening forecasts are reissued with updated rainfall forecasts.
